Honors and Distinctions:
- 2013 Poylmeric Materials Science and Engineering Fellow for innovative contributions to polymer synthesis and nanocomposite assembly
- 2011 Chair, Macromolecular Materials Gordon Research Conference, Ventura CA
- 2011 Chair, Polymeric Materials Science & Engineering (PMSE) Division of the ACS
- 2010 Milestone Award from the Intellectual Property office at UMass (for >5 awarded patents)
- 2010 Keynote lecture at Bayer MaterialScience Innovation Technology Symposium
- 2008 Featured speaker at Hybrid Materials 2009, Tours, France
- 2006 Arthur K. Doolittle Award from the Polymer Materials Science & Engineering (PMSE) Division of the American Chemical Society
- 2005 Juniata College Young Alumni Achievement Award
- 2004 University of Massachusetts President's Office Technology Development Award
- 2003 Selected by the NSF as a U.S. delegate to the CERC-3 in Gotenborg, Sweden
- 2003-2008 NSF CAREER Award
- 2002 Exploratory Research Award from the Center for UMass-Industry Research on Polymers (CUMIRP).
- 2001 Omnova, Inc. Signature Young Faculty Award
